Rob

If the layout is an honest 24" wide, you will want 10" radius curves, not 12". Radius is measured to the centerline of the track, not the tie edge. Anything more than 11" radius is going to overhang the edge. 10" radius gives you 2" space from track centerline to table edge - about minimum for my taste.

10" radius curves do work in HO. For American prototype, small steam tank engines (think Docksider and the like) and rolling stock 40 scale feet or shorter (preferably shorter) will generally work. On the cars, you may need truck mounted couplers instead of body mounts for reasonable operation on the curves.

Something worth considering for both track plans and benchwork are the 30" x 80" N scale hollow-core door layouts. These typically use 11" radius. Admittedly, the track plans will have to be modified to widen parallel track spacing and reduce the number of spurs. But they should give you some ideas.

Open to any thoughts or feedback.

Is a continous run loop a given ?

You can fit a pretty nice scene in 2x6 or 2x8 feet if you have the track run e.g under a bridge at the end of the scene out onto a detachable cassette - so you can move a train off the layout to a staging track on a shelf elsewhere or turn it around.

Well, the ability to fold when not in use may still allow you to build it. And even if you don't do that one, you could still use Thomas, Percy, Toby, and Mavis. All have decent pulling power and do well on tight curves because of the small chassis. And the small rolling stock? Lovely for small-radius curves also. And finally, tension-lock couplers do better than horn-hook or knuckle around small-radius curves(Knuckle couplers are alright, but if the spring comes out they'll pop open around tight bends.
